Your PAYE Breakdown: What’s Deducted from Your Pay?

Kia ora! Our PAYE tax calculator NZ shows exactly what comes out of your pay. We break down tax, ACC, KiwiSaver, and more. All calculations use 2025 IRD rates for accuracy. See your net pay clearly and plan your budget.

PAYE Income Tax

NZ taxes income at progressive rates. For 2025, you pay 10.5% on $0–$15,600, up to 39% over $180,000.
Example: On $100,000, you pay $22,990 in tax.
Source: IRD Tax Rates.

ACC Levies

ACC covers non-work injuries. It’s $1.60 per $100 earned, capped at $150,988.
Example: For $100,000, ACC takes $1,600.
Source: ACC Levy Rates.

KiwiSaver Contributions

You choose 3%, 4%, 6%, 8%, or 10%. Employers match up to 3%. Saves for retirement or a first home.
Example: At 8% on $100,000, you contribute $8,000; employer adds $3,000.

NZ PAYE Tax Brackets: How They Work in 2025

Kia ora! Our PAYE tax calculator NZ explains how tax brackets work. NZ uses progressive tax rates for 2025. Your income splits into brackets, each taxed differently. We use 2025 IRD rates for accuracy. Understand your tax and plan smarter with our inland revenue paye calculator.

2025–2026 Tax Rates

NZ taxes income in tiers. Higher income means higher rates. Here are the 2025 brackets:

  • $0–$15,600: 10.5%
  • $15,601–$53,500: 17.5%
  • $53,501–$78,100: 30%
  • $78,101–$180,000: 33%
  • $180,001+: 39%
    Example: Earn $50,000? First $15,600 at 10.5%, next $34,400 at 17.5%.
    Source: IRD Tax Rates

Secondary Income Tax Codes

Got multiple jobs? Use a secondary tax code (SB, S, SH, ST) for extra income.

  • SB: For income up to $15,600 (10.5%).
  • S: For income $15,601–$53,500 (17.5%).
  • SH: For income $53,501–$78,100 (30%).
  • ST: For income $78,101+ (33% or 39%).
    Example: Main job $40,000, side gig $10,000? Use S code for side gig.
    Tooltip: Check your code on IRD’s tax code guide.

Simplify Payroll with Our PAYE Calculator (For Employers)

Kia ora! Our payroll calculator NZ makes paying employees easy. Handle PAYE, ACC, KiwiSaver, and student loans effortlessly. File with Inland Revenue via myIR. Use our employer PAYE calculator for accurate results. Save time and stay compliant with 2025 IRD rules.

Your Payroll Responsibilities

Deduct PAYE, ACC, KiwiSaver, and student loans from employee wages. File deductions via myIR. Register as an employer with IRD’s IR334 form. Submit employee details like tax codes (IR330).
Example: Pay a $60,000 employee? See deductions instantly.
Source: IRD Employer Registration

Employer Superannuation Contribution Tax (ESCT)

Pay ESCT on KiwiSaver contributions. Rates range from 10.5% to 39%, based on employee salary.
Example: For $60,000 salary, ESCT at 17.5% is $525 on 3% contribution.
Source: IRD ESCT Rates

Payday Filing

File PAYE electronically if deductions exceed $50,000 yearly. Use myIR or payroll software. Submit within two days of payday. Paper filing allowed for smaller businesses.
Example: Pay weekly? File every Friday via myIR.
Source: IRD Payday Filing

For Self-Employed and Contractors: Estimate Your Tax

Kia ora! Our self-employed tax calculator NZ helps freelancers and contractors estimate taxes. Calculate schedular payments, ACC levies, and provisional tax easily. Use our ird pay calculator for accurate 2025 results. Stay on top of your contractor PAYE NZ obligations

Schedular Payments

Contractors get schedular payments with tax deducted at source. Rates range from 10% to 100%; you choose based on income. Excludes ACC and KiwiSaver.
Example: Freelancer earning $80,000? Pick a 20% rate for $16,000 tax withheld.
Source: IRD Schedular Payments

ACC Levies for Self-Employed

Pay ACC levies for injury cover. Choose CoverPlus (80% of last year’s income) or CoverPlus Extra (set your cover level). Rates depend on industry risk.
Example: $80,000 income, medium-risk industry? Pay ~$2,080 (Earners’ $1,160, Work $840, Safer $80).
Source: ACC Levy Estimator

Provisional Tax Estimator

Pay provisional tax quarterly if expected tax exceeds $5,000. Based on net profit after expenses. File via IR3 return.
Example: $80,000 income, $20,000 expenses? Tax on $60,000 is ~$14,350, paid in three instalments.
Source: IRD Provisional Tax
